Hi all,
I've been using CakePHP for 3-4 years, and I just downloaded and
started to check the 2.0 version.
One thing that I didn't like about 1.x version, and apparently didn't
change on 2.0, is the prefix routing. IMO, backend and frontend
methods on the same controller isn't a good idea. So, on 1.x, I made
some changes on the core, allowing me to have a different folder
inside controllers directory, called "admin", containing the backend
controllers. And all of them extending an "AdminController", where I
created a lot of default methods (index, add, edit, etc), which made
my life easier.
Now, the question: is there any way I can keep using two different
controllers, with the same name, but different folders, for frontend
and backend, on 2.0, without changing Cake's core again?
